Winner of Crafts magazine's award for the best craft book of its year, Spinning Wheels, Spinners & Spinning has established itself as the most complete account yet published of the history of the spinning wheel and of spinning techniques. Historically, it traces the spinning wheel's evolution from the 13th century to the present day; technically, it covers the construction and workings of spinning wheels and spinning methods and through its illustrations, it provides an invaluable guide to the identification and dating of different types of wheel.
The practical sections give instructions on making a variety of yarns, on spinning flax and silk, and on choosing and sorting wool. 101 photographs and 17 diagrams.
